Understanding the Common Reasons

During the initial stage of community building, it’s easy to feel overwhelmed due to the multitude of tasks that demand your attention.

Juggling community management, creating paid and free content, managing systems, running paid ads, and handling everything alone can take a toll on your work-life balance.

The lack of a proper support system further exacerbates the situation.

Additionally, not setting clear boundaries between personal and work time can lead to overcommitment and burnout.

When your audience perceives you as always available, it can create unrealistic expectations, making you feel like you owe them constant attention.

Finding the Solution

To maintain Work-Life balance while building your community, consider implementing the following strategies:

  1. Set Clear Boundaries: Establish defined working hours and personal time. Communicate these boundaries to your community, team, and family to ensure that you have dedicated time for both work and personal life.
  2. Allocate Specific Time for Answering Questions: Instead of being constantly available, designate specific time slots for answering questions and queries. Conduct weekly Q&A sessions and dedicate a specific time each day for addressing community queries.
  3. Practice Self-Care: Prioritize self-care to maintain your physical and mental well-being. Regular exercise, meditation, and quality rest are essential for sustaining your productivity and creativity.
  4. Prioritize Daily Tasks: Create a daily task list, prioritizing the most critical activities. Focus on completing high-priority tasks first to reduce overwhelm and maintain focus.
  5. Evaluate and Adjust: Monitor your energy levels throughout the day and adjust your schedule accordingly. Recognize when you’re most productive and utilize those peak times for critical tasks.
  6. Learn to Say No: While it’s tempting to take on every opportunity that comes your way, saying no to certain commitments is essential for maintaining balance. Focus on activities that align with your long-term goals.
